Understanding Auto Detailing Pricing Quotes


Auto detailing pricing quotes can vary widely depending on several factors. Knowing what influences these prices will help you ask the right questions and avoid surprises.


  • Type of Service: Basic washes, interior cleaning, waxing, paint correction, and ceramic coating all come with different price tags.

  • Vehicle Size and Condition: Larger vehicles or those with heavy dirt and damage usually cost more to detail.

  • Location: Prices can differ based on your geographic area and the local market.

  • Detailing Packages: Some mobile detailers offer bundled services at a discount, while others charge per service.


When requesting mobile detailing pricing quotes, be specific about your vehicle type and the services you want. This helps the provider give you an accurate estimate.

How to Request Auto Detailing Pricing Quotes Effectively


Getting clear and detailed quotes requires a strategic approach. Here are some tips to help you request quotes that are easy to compare and understand:


  1. Provide Detailed Information

    Include your vehicle’s make, model, year, and current condition. Mention any specific areas you want detailed, such as pet hair removal or engine cleaning.


  2. Ask for a Breakdown of Services

    Request a detailed list of what each package or service includes. This helps you see what you’re paying for and avoid hidden fees.


  3. Inquire About Additional Costs

    Some shops may charge extra for things like heavy stains, pet hair, or large SUVs. Clarify these potential costs upfront.


  4. Request Time Estimates

    Knowing how long the service will take can help you plan your day and assess if the price matches the time invested.


  5. Check for Discounts or Promotions

    Ask if there are any current deals or loyalty programs that could reduce your cost.



By following these steps, you can ensure the quotes you receive are comprehensive and comparable.


How much should I tip for a $200 car detail?


Tipping is a common practice in the detailing industry, especially when you receive excellent service. For a $200 car detail, a standard tip ranges from 15% to 20% of the total cost. This means you might consider tipping between $30 and $40.


Here are some additional tipping tips:


  • Consider the quality of service: If the detailer went above and beyond, a higher tip is a nice way to show appreciation.

  • Tip in cash: This is often preferred and ensures the detailer receives the full amount.

  • Tip individually if multiple workers are involved: If more than one person worked on your car, consider tipping each worker separately.


Tipping is not mandatory but is a great way to acknowledge hard work and encourage excellent service in the future.

Questions to Ask When Comparing Auto Detailing Quotes


When you receive multiple quotes, it’s important to ask the right questions to make an informed decision:


  • What products do you use?

High-quality, eco-friendly products can protect your vehicle better and reduce environmental impact.


  • Are your technicians certified or trained?

Experienced detailers are more likely to deliver superior results.


  • Do you offer any guarantees or warranties?

Some shops guarantee their work for a certain period, which adds peace of mind.


  • Can you provide references or reviews?

Customer feedback can reveal the reliability and quality of the service.


  • What is your cancellation or rescheduling policy?

Flexibility can be important if your plans change.


Asking these questions will help you evaluate the professionalism and value of each service provider beyond just the price.
